House Blessing

With Spring in full swing...spring cleaning has come to mind. What a perfect time to bless our home. We have plans for lots of entertaining this summer and hope to infuse a blessing for those who visit as well. It was a three day process for me. Day one I spent my time clearing our space of clutter, checking closets and behind furniture not moved often. Day two I spend cleaning,sweeping dusting and washing. Day three is the blessing day, I start with a bathing ritual and prepare myself for the ritual.

I started in the kitchen and made a pitcher of Strawberry Lemonade and baked my families favorite lemon loaf.

I take my Ritual Besom and sweep away the negative energy from every room, ending at the back door.

With a sage and lavender wand and going from room to room recite;

Ritual Bessom

4 ft Branch for handle
handful of thinner 1 ft twigs (bristles)
Cord or twine to bind.

Soak the twigs over night in water to soften

Tie the bristles to the handle on the ground make sure bristles are upside down. Tie in place near bottom of the handle.Flip bristles cascade gently around the cord and covering it. Bristles should be on the bottom of broom.
Tie another length of cord securing bristles. Let dry a day or two and bless.

It is best to make during crone.

Esbat Cakes

1 cup finely ground almonds
1 1/4 cup flour
1/2 cup confectioners sugar
2 drops almond extract
1/2 cup butter, softened
1 egg yolk
Combine almonds, flour, sugar and extract until throughly mixed. With hands, work
in butter and egg yolk until throroughly well blended.
Chill dough for at least an hour.
Preheat oven to 325 degrees.
Pinch off pieces of dough about the size of a walnut and shape into crescents. Place
on a greased sheet and bake for 20 mins.

Blessing Oil

1/8 Cup Almond Oil
5 drops Sandlewood
2 drops Camphor
1 drop orange
1 drop Patchouli

As you blend the oils visualize your intent, take in the aroma, know that this oil is sacred and magical.
